This property is not currently for sale or for rent on Trulia. The description and property data below may have been provided by a third party, the homeowner or public records.
This apartment is located at 107 Myrtle St #1, Lowell, MA. 107 Myrtle St #1 is in the Centralville neighborhood in Lowell, MA and in ZIP code 01850. This property has 3 bedrooms, 1 bathroom and approximately 1,100 sqft of floor space.
